The r011 Call vote was as follows: <br />AYES: Councilmembers Dennis, Michelotti, Mohr, Pico, and Mayor Tarver ' <br />NOES: None <br />ABSENT: None <br />ABSTAIN: None <br /> <br />Item 6g <br />Levy Of Annual AssesSmentS for Pleasanton Downtown Business ImprOvement Di~;rict <br />(S R95: 175 ) <br /> <br /> Ms. Rossi presented the staff report. <br /> <br /> Mayor Tarver opened the public hearing. There being no testimony, the public hearing <br />was closed. <br /> <br /> It was moved by Ms. Michelotti, and seconded by Ms. Dennis, that Resolution No. 95-62, <br />be adopted, to order the levy of annual assessments for the Pleasanton Downtown Business <br />Improvement District. <br /> <br />The roll call vote was as followS: <br />AYES: Councilmembers Dennis, Michelotti, Mohr, and Mayor Tarver <br />NOES: None <br />ABSENT: None <br />ABSTAIN: Councilmember Pico <br /> <br />Item 6f <br />1994-95 Third Quarter Financial Report (SR95: 188) <br /> <br /> Ms. Rossi presented the staff report. <br /> <br /> Mr. Pico stated that the budget amendment projects an increase of $2 millon dollars. <br /> <br /> Ms. Rossi stated that the original budget projections were made a year ago before the <br />second and third quarter sales taxes were received. The sales tax came in so much higher that <br />it became the base for the current year. <br /> <br /> Mr. Pico noticed a new "Urban Forestry Fund" and it has a small amount of money in <br />it. <br /> <br /> Ms. Rossi stated that it is a new fund that was created in the mid year report and the <br />money in the account pertains to heritage trees.
